Comic book fans of the world - were you planning on spending your spare cash on anything other than cinema visits and DVD box-sets for the next six years? Well tough, because Hollywood has other ideas.
Ever since Bryan Singer’s X-Men movie jump-started the comic book movie trend in 2000 (building on the stellar work of Richard Donner and Tim Burton in the decades prior), Fox, Sony, Warner Bros., Disney and Marvel Studios have all been repeatedly cashing-in on the resurgent popularity of capes, cowls and anything ending in ‘Man’.

Box Office Despite the failure of other recent swords-and-sandals movies and the fact that it's been seven years since the original, 300: Rise of an Empire is expected to rule the box office this weekend. In light of its $3.3 million Thursday late-night take and estimated $16 million-plus Friday, the sequel to 300 is predicted to have a $40 million-plus debut at the domestic box office. The movie is also doing well overseas, taking in an estimated $12.1 million in its first two days.

Two things stick out very vividly in memory from watching ‘Dead Right’ early on in my youthful days late, late Saturday nights (right after my local news). One, Demi Moore was a foxy chick. She was a two-sided coin, gorgeous and tough edged. A totally memorable girl. And two, Jeffery Tambor, long before he became known to me before another cult show (you know the one), was totally and straight up believable as a greasy, grimy overweight slob — even as I see now that it’s really funky make-up and a lumpy fatsuit.
It’s a simple tale. Gold digging girl meets boy with the promises that said boy will inherit money and die a violent death. So, she pushes him away because he’s a digusting lout (and baby, I can attest to that) but gives in because money’s money and to Ms. Cathy Fince nee Marno, it makes the world go ’round.
